Requeening aggressive hives is unfortunately part of my Cost of Doing Business.
In my location (Los Angeles CA area) I typically see an 8-10 week period before I can confidently put a requeened hive into a homeowner's back yard. Occasionally I have seen an instant calming effect but it doesn't stay long with my local AHB's. More typically I will see these workers accept a docile queen only with extended caging, and then go ahead and supersede anyway 3 weeks later.
